Martín Gonzalo del Campo (born 24 May 1975 in Montevideo) is a former Uruguayan footballer.[1]

Club career

Del Campo played for River Plate in the Primera División de Argentina.[2]

International career

Del Campo made five appearances for the senior Uruguay national football team during 1999,[1] including four matches at the Copa América 1999.
